Output dd7aba217fe4b231ecdc1c540044e8b01346a5225a6fcebd5d011a7ccc899f26:1

value
10605240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 568cb87c3121e1636c0ea279762a29a3e89f36b0 OP_EQUAL
address
39aecUy3wcz7MgKC4jU4cVetUR4BWa3tMK
transaction
dd7aba217fe4b231ecdc1c540044e8b01346a5225a6fcebd5d011a7ccc899f26
spent
true